Linting Rules - OpenAPI V3 - Use of Response Schema oneOf
Number of APIs: 1
This is a Spectral governance rule to enforce that check to see if oneOf property is being used as part of the schema for any OpenAPI. Here is a JSON version of the rule that can be applied using this API-driven collection API, or at CLI or CI/CD pipeline.
{
"openapi-v3-use-of-response-schema-oneof": {
"description": "Checks to see if oneOf is being used as part of each schema.",
"message": "You should avoid using oneOf as part of your schema.",
"given": "$.paths.*.*[responses]..content..schema",
"severity": "warn",
"formats": [
"oas3"
],
"then": {
"field": "oneOf",
"function": "falsy"
}
}
}
